BREWER and BANGOR – Thelma Bell, 86, wife of the late Hartley J. Bell, died July 3, 2005, at a Bangor healthcare facility. She was born April 10, 1919, in Orrington, the daughter of Charles and Augusta (Christensen) Prahm. Mrs. Bell was a life-long resident of Bangor, spent summers at her cottage at Lucerne and for 20 years, spent winters in Casselberry, Fla. Mrs. Bell was employed with the Savings and Loan of Bangor for many years, retiring as vice president in 1978. Mrs. Bell was a life-long Rebekah, and member of Vashti Rebekah Lodge, Orrington and served on the state level as president of the Rebecca Assembly of Maine in 1975-1976. She was a former active member of the Grace United Methodist Church, the Altrusa Club and the Queen City Grange. Surviving are one daughter, Donna B.
